Earnings for Mechanical Engineering Graduates from University of California-Merced
Graduates of University of California-Merced’s Mechanical Engineering program earn the following amounts (per the U.S. Department of Education’s College Scorecard):
| Years After Graduation | Median Earnings |
|---|---|
| 1 year | $55,936 |
| 2 years | $51,392 |
| 3 years | $67,761 |
| 4 years | $78,386 |
| 5 years | $85,156 |
How does this compare to the school overall? Four years after graduating, Mechanical Engineering graduates from University of California-Merced take home a median $78,386, compared with $62,823 for all University of California-Merced graduates — about 25% higher than the school-wide median.
Median Debt at Graduation
The median debt for Mechanical Engineering graduates from University of California-Merced stands at $18,500.
Student Demographics & Diversity
Take a look at the composition of Mechanical Engineering graduates at University of California-Merced, broken down by degree level.
Across all degree levels, Mechanical Engineering graduates at University of California-Merced are 12% women (18) and 88% men (134).
Mechanical Engineering Bachelor’s Program at University of California-Merced
Among the 139 bachelor’s mechanical engineering graduates at University of California-Merced, 12% were women (16) and 88% were men (123).
The following table and chart show the race/ethnicity of Mechanical Engineering bachelor’s degree recipients at University of California-Merced.
| Race / Ethnicity | Number of Graduates |
|---|---|
| White | 9 |
| Hispanic / Latino | 100 |
| Asian | 21 |
| Native Hawaiian / Pacific Islander | 2 |
| Two or More Races | 3 |
| International (Nonresident) | 2 |
| Unknown | 2 |
Racial-ethnic minorities make up 91% of Mechanical Engineering bachelor’s degree recipients at University of California-Merced, above the national average of 34%.*
